91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

java如何讀取xml文件內容

小億
87
2024-04-16 18:55:09
欄目: 編程語言

在Java中讀取XML文件內容通常使用DOM(文檔對象模型)或者SAX(簡單API for XML)解析器。以下是使用DOM解析器讀取XML文件內容的步驟:

  1. 創建一個DocumentBuilder對象,可以通過DocumentBuilderFactory類的靜態方法newInstance()來獲取。
DocumentBuilderFactory factory = DocumentBuilderFactory.newInstance();
DocumentBuilder builder = factory.newDocumentBuilder();
  1. 使用DocumentBuilder對象的parse()方法解析XML文件,將其轉換為Document對象。
Document document = builder.parse(new File("file.xml"));
  1. 通過Document對象獲取XML文件的根元素。
Element rootElement = document.getDocumentElement();
  1. 使用Element對象的方法來獲取XML文件中的節點內容,例如獲取某個節點的子節點或屬性值。
NodeList nodeList = rootElement.getElementsByTagName("elementName");
for (int i = 0; i < nodeList.getLength(); i++) {
    Element element = (Element) nodeList.item(i);
    String content = element.getTextContent();
    // 處理節點內容
}

以上是使用DOM解析器讀取XML文件內容的基本步驟。如果需要更靈活地處理XML文件內容,也可以考慮使用SAX解析器。SAX解析器是基于事件驅動的,通過實現ContentHandler接口中的方法處理XML文件中的節點內容。

0
宁德市| 青田县| 巨鹿县| 邻水| 广安市| 巩留县| 丰原市| 呼伦贝尔市| 金平| 宕昌县| 湾仔区| 东乡族自治县| 宽城| 井冈山市| 襄汾县| 庄浪县| 屏南县| 涞源县| 枝江市| 如东县| 松潘县| 鄂托克前旗| 西充县| 新宾| 郎溪县| 墨竹工卡县| 察雅县| 沽源县| 松溪县| 福建省| 福鼎市| 德保县| 双牌县| 东兰县| 文成县| 洞头县| 新绛县| 淳化县| 夹江县| 上杭县| 澎湖县|